The most important exemption from creditors in Florida is the Florida homestead exemption. Florida head-of-family exemption If a person makes $750 or less per week in net wages, and the person is a head of family, those wages are exempt from collection. The homestead exemption in Florida protects up to 1/2 acre of real property in a city and up to 160 acres in the county from property liens and forced sale. In Florida joint bank accounts are presumed to be entireties property and therefore exempt from a creditor of only 1 spouse. One of the first things a creditor will do after obtaining a money judgment is serve a writ of wage garnishment on the debtor’s employer. Some debtors inadvertently waive Florida asset protections by signing documents during a loan closing that include exemption waivers.. To be effective and enforceable, exemptions waivers must be conspicuous and not hidden from reasonable discovery in fine print legalize. Florida statutes provide several specific creditor exemptions such as exemptions of professionally prescribed health aids, hurricane savings accounts (with restrictions), medical savings accounts, and unemployment benefits. Disability income benefits under any disability insurance policy are exempt from collection under Section 222.18 of the Florida Statute. A home that is owned and lived in by the creditor can be exempted from a judgment under Florida's homestead law. The same percentage (15%) of monthly social security payments may be garnished to enforce a court award of alimony or child support. The U.S. Government may garnish up to 15% of social security checks to collect money owed to the federal government. Florida statute 222.14 provides that annuities and annuity proceeds are exempt from creditors.Generally, an annuity is a contract to pay money to a beneficiary over timer in periodic payments. Under state and federal law, not all property can be taken to satisfy a creditor judgment. Article X, Section 4 of The Florida Constitution states that homestead property in Florida is “exempt from forced sale under process of any court.” This means that judgment creditors cannot levy and execute on property that falls within the definition of a Florida homestead. A homeowner can lose their homestead by failing to pay property taxes, mortgages or repairs or improvements which are properly perfected as a construction lien that is properly foreclosed. Many lenders include waiver provisions in their standard loan documents. Bankruptcy exemptions describe the personal and real property a bankruptcy debtor may keep through the bankruptcy process and retain after the bankruptcy. This homestead exemption is not applicable to a judgment creditor who holds a mortgage or lien against the home.
